MORE THAN 56 THOUSAND TONNES OF FOOD GRAINS AND SALT

HAVE REACHED BY 29 RAKES AT ADRA DIVISION OF SOUTH EASTERN RAILWAY IN THE MONTH OF OCTOBER

 

 

Kolkata, 16th November, 2020:

     

          South Eastern Railway has continued its endeavour to ensure transportation of food grains and other essential commodities through its freight services during nationwide crisis in the wake of COVID-19 pandemic. As per the guidelines issued by the Ministry of Railways, SER has geared up its entire network for uninterrupted movement of goods trains. 

 

During the period from 1st October to 31stOctober, 2020, altogether 56,642 tonnes of food grains and salt have been unloaded from 29 rakes of food grain which arrived at different stations and sidings of Adra Division of South Eastern Railway. Altogether 35,732 tonnes of wheat was unloaded from 16 rakes and 19,578 tonnes of rice was unloaded from 12 rakes. Moreover, 1,332 tonnes of salt was unloaded from 1 rake.

 

The rakes were unloaded at different locations of Adra Division of South Eastern Railway viz. Purulia, Bankura, Bokaro Steel City, Adra, etc. during the period from 1st October to 31stOctober, 2020. The concerned staff of South Eastern Railway have been working at various stations and goods sheds for unloading and loading of food grains and essential commodities maintaining health protocols. Security personnel have also been deployed at different loading and unloading sites for security of food grains and other commodities.
